It has been argued in the literature (George (1980), Chomsky (1986), Agbayani (2000, 2006), among others) that a movement operation without an effect on PF output can be suspended. This is known as the vacuous movement hypothesis. In this paper, it is shown, based on recent minimalist frameworks (Chomsky (2000, 2001, 2004, 2008)), that the vacuous movement hypothesis is reducible to an explanatory system in which the mechanism of feature inheritance operates not only on the Agree feature but also on the edge feature, which draws on clausal typing (Cheng (1997a)). The proposed system is also shown to have favorable consequences and implications.
